The KISJ Virtual School daily checklist was developed as an informational and organizational tool for students. Parents can also use this as a guide to support and ensure students virtual learning success. Take a moment to review each item with your child on a weekly basis to reinforce learning expectations and support their emotional well-being.
Learning Tools. These are the materials that students will need to successfully participate in the virtual school learning environment. A dedicated, clean work space with all of their school materials (notebooks, pencils/pens, art supplies, etc.), iPad/MacBook and charger.
Teacher Communication. Teachers will be available to students from 8:00AM to 4:00PM, Monday through Friday. Students should follow their regular school schedule.
Good Habits. Students should check Seesaw or Google Classroom (G5 only) everyday. Complete all tasks assigned within their given time frame. Ask questions and seek clarification when needed. Be respectful, responsible, and kind online. Follow the KISJ Responsible Use of Technology Policy. Practice academic honesty by doing their own work. Take daily lunch and transitional breaks to rest their eyes and rejuvenate their bodies.
Feeling Stressed. Virtual school can be overwhelming. If students are feeling stressed about school or life encourage them to reach out to their Teachers, Counselors, Advisors, or Parents/Guardians.

Using the Seesaw Family app. Learn how parents can message their child's teacher privately.
Family members can add voice comments to student work, text comments to student work, or attachments to messages, but cannot add posts to the journal.
To add a comment, please go to ‘Notifications’ in the Family app and tap the post you’d like to comment on. At the bottom of the post you can tap ‘Comment’ to leave a comment for your student.
Clicking on the “HOME” tab will show your child’s most recent post in ALL subject areas they are enrolled.
Clicking on the “JOURNAL” tab will allow you to view the specific classes your children are enrolled in.
Here you can navigate to a specific class and see post specific to that class.
This is where you can scroll down to view all of the posts your child made.
